summaryrefslogtreecommitdiffstats
path: root/audio/cheesetracker
diff options
context:
space:
mode:
authorijliao <ijliao@FreeBSD.org>2002-01-31 09:18:13 +0000
committerijliao <ijliao@FreeBSD.org>2002-01-31 09:18:13 +0000
commitf5a7e4432c5fb0768ecf536e291703fef96a5cfe (patch)
tree6813f5758ebbb690436a27f51e8fc86815d1dadc /audio/cheesetracker
parentc098b9cf38a2d2b3dc236318a8e3404622be2f0f (diff)
downloadFreeBSD-ports-f5a7e4432c5fb0768ecf536e291703fef96a5cfe.zip
FreeBSD-ports-f5a7e4432c5fb0768ecf536e291703fef96a5cfe.tar.gz
add cheesetracker 0.2.4
An Impulse Tracker clone
Diffstat (limited to 'audio/cheesetracker')
-rw-r--r--audio/cheesetracker/Makefile30
-rw-r--r--audio/cheesetracker/distinfo1
-rw-r--r--audio/cheesetracker/files/patch-interface_gtk::Makefile.in7
-rw-r--r--audio/cheesetracker/files/patch-program::Makefile7
-rw-r--r--audio/cheesetracker/pkg-comment1
-rw-r--r--audio/cheesetracker/pkg-descr4
-rw-r--r--audio/cheesetracker/pkg-plist1
7 files changed, 51 insertions, 0 deletions
diff --git a/audio/cheesetracker/Makefile b/audio/cheesetracker/Makefile
new file mode 100644
index 0000000..fb377e3
--- /dev/null
+++ b/audio/cheesetracker/Makefile
@@ -0,0 +1,30 @@
+# ex:ts=8
+# Ports collection makefile for: cheesetracker
+# Date created: Jan 31, 2002
+# Whom: ijliao
+#
+# $FreeBSD$
+#
+
+PORTNAME= cheesetracker
+PORTVERSION= 0.2.4
+CATEGORIES= audio
+MASTER_SITES= http://www.reduz.com.ar/cheesetracker/
+
+MAINTAINER= ports@FreeBSD.org
+
+LIB_DEPENDS= sigc:${PORTSDIR}/devel/libsigc++ \
+ gtkmm:${PORTSDIR}/x11-toolkits/gtk--
+
+GNU_CONFIGURE= yes
+USE_GMAKE= yes
+
+pre-configure:
+.for file in install-sh missing mkinstalldirs
+ @${LN} -sf ${LOCALBASE}/share/automake14/automake/${file} ${WRKSRC}
+.endfor
+
+post-patch:
+ @${PERL} -pi -e "s,AFMT_S16_NE,AFMT_S16_LE,g" ${WRKSRC}/waveout/sound_driver_oss.cpp
+
+.include <bsd.port.mk>
diff --git a/audio/cheesetracker/distinfo b/audio/cheesetracker/distinfo
new file mode 100644
index 0000000..6db418e
--- /dev/null
+++ b/audio/cheesetracker/distinfo
@@ -0,0 +1 @@
+MD5 (cheesetracker-0.2.4.tar.gz) = 6b219084991d460b289c9acd8b7e1388
diff --git a/audio/cheesetracker/files/patch-interface_gtk::Makefile.in b/audio/cheesetracker/files/patch-interface_gtk::Makefile.in
new file mode 100644
index 0000000..6ed4d0d
--- /dev/null
+++ b/audio/cheesetracker/files/patch-interface_gtk::Makefile.in
@@ -0,0 +1,7 @@
+--- interface_gtk/Makefile.in.orig Thu Jan 31 16:27:58 2002
++++ interface_gtk/Makefile.in Thu Jan 31 16:28:14 2002
+@@ -75,3 +75,3 @@
+ noinst_LIBRARIES = libinterface_gtk.a
+-CXXFLAGS = @CXXFLAGS@ -I../trackercore -I../editor
++CXXFLAGS = @CXXFLAGS@ -I../trackercore -I../editor -fhuge-objects
+
diff --git a/audio/cheesetracker/files/patch-program::Makefile b/audio/cheesetracker/files/patch-program::Makefile
new file mode 100644
index 0000000..529948e
--- /dev/null
+++ b/audio/cheesetracker/files/patch-program::Makefile
@@ -0,0 +1,7 @@
+--- program/Makefile.in.orig Thu Jan 31 16:53:00 2002
++++ program/Makefile.in Thu Jan 31 16:53:23 2002
+@@ -74,3 +74,3 @@
+
+-CXXFLAGS = @CXXFLAGS@ $(SIGC_CFLAGS) -I../trackercore -I../editor -I../posix -I../waveout -I../interface_gtk
++CXXFLAGS = @CXXFLAGS@ $(SIGC_CFLAGS) -I../trackercore -I../editor -I../posix -I../waveout -I../interface_gtk -fhuge-objects
+
diff --git a/audio/cheesetracker/pkg-comment b/audio/cheesetracker/pkg-comment
new file mode 100644
index 0000000..4ae6b04
--- /dev/null
+++ b/audio/cheesetracker/pkg-comment
@@ -0,0 +1 @@
+An Impulse Tracker clone
diff --git a/audio/cheesetracker/pkg-descr b/audio/cheesetracker/pkg-descr
new file mode 100644
index 0000000..0d9ef68
--- /dev/null
+++ b/audio/cheesetracker/pkg-descr
@@ -0,0 +1,4 @@
+CheeseTracker is intended to be an Impulse Tracker clone. Yet, even when
+some features are missing, It should be perfectly usable.
+
+WWW: http://www.reduz.com.ar/cheesetracker/
diff --git a/audio/cheesetracker/pkg-plist b/audio/cheesetracker/pkg-plist
new file mode 100644
index 0000000..bffe37c
--- /dev/null
+++ b/audio/cheesetracker/pkg-plist
@@ -0,0 +1 @@
+bin/cheesetracker
OpenPOWER on IntegriCloud